在数学的广阔天地中,有许多令人惊叹的定理和公式,它们如同璀璨的星辰,照亮了人类探索数学奥秘的道路。今天,我们要揭开的是欧拉定理的神秘面纱,探索这个数学中的神奇公式及其在各个领域的广泛应用。
欧拉定理的起源
欧拉定理是由瑞士数学家莱昂哈德·欧拉在18世纪提出的。欧拉是数学史上最伟大的数学家之一,他的研究成果涵盖了数学的各个分支,对后世产生了深远的影响。欧拉定理是数论中的一个基本定理,它揭示了整数与模数之间的关系。
欧拉定理的定义
欧拉定理可以表述为:设整数a和n互质,即它们的最大公约数为1,那么a的n-1次方除以n的余数等于1。用数学公式表示为:
[ a^{n-1} \equiv 1 \ (\text{mod}\ n) ]
其中,( \equiv ) 表示同余,( \text{mod}\ n ) 表示模n。
欧拉定理的证明
欧拉定理的证明有多种方法,以下是一种较为简洁的证明:
假设整数a和n互质,即它们的最大公约数为1。根据费马小定理,我们知道:
[ a^{n-1} \equiv 1 \ (\text{mod}\ p) ]
其中,p是n的一个质因数。由于n可以分解为若干个质数的乘积,我们可以将上述同余式推广到n:
[ a^{n-1} \equiv 1 \ (\text{mod}\ n) ]
这就完成了欧拉定理的证明。
欧拉定理的应用
欧拉定理在数学和计算机科学等领域有着广泛的应用,以下是一些典型的应用场景:
密码学:欧拉定理在密码学中有着重要的应用,特别是在RSA加密算法中。RSA算法的安全性依赖于大整数的分解,而欧拉定理可以帮助我们快速判断两个大整数是否互质。
数论:欧拉定理是数论中的一个基本工具,可以用来研究整数序列的性质,例如欧拉函数。
计算机科学:在计算机科学中,欧拉定理可以用来优化算法,例如在求解线性方程组时,可以使用欧拉定理来简化计算。
数学竞赛:欧拉定理是数学竞赛中常见的考点,它可以帮助参赛者解决一些复杂的数学问题。
总结
欧拉定理是数学中的一个神奇公式,它揭示了整数与模数之间的关系。通过本文的介绍,我们了解了欧拉定理的定义、证明和应用。欧拉定理在数学和计算机科学等领域有着广泛的应用,它为人类探索数学奥秘提供了有力的工具。让我们一起继续探索数学的奇妙世界吧!
